MILNE, A.A.; SHEPARD, E.H. (illustrator).
Winnie-The-Pooh.
Winnie-The-Pooh.
Stock Code 120058
London, Methuen, 1926.
'how lucky am I?'
A beautifully bound first edition of one of the most famous children's titles in the world; telling the adventures and antics of Winnie-the-Pooh, Christopher Robin, Piglet, Kanga and Eeyore.First edition; 8vo (190 x 135 mm); illustrations throughout by E.H. Shepard; three minor spots to verso of dedication page and a couple of spots to p.62 with one offset to page opposite, otherwise internally near-fine; beautiful, modern full green morocco binding by Sangorski and Sutcliffe, one set of original map endpapers (browned) bound in, one-line gilt panelled back, gilt block of Christopher Robin and Pooh after the original, Japanese endpapers and all edges gilt, fine; x, [3], 158, [1]pp.
